Better possibilities

What do you want for your life, for all of life? How can you be sure there’s not something much, much better?

Could you be seeking some particular thing so single-mindedly that you fail to see other, more desirable possibilities? Might you be sabotaging your own fulfillment by envisioning fulfillment in a far too limited way?

It’s all well and good to get what you desire. But perhaps it’s even better sometimes when you don’t get what you desire.

When your path to fulfillment is blocked, you’re forced to consider other paths. That’s not such a bad thing.

Surely there are possibilities you’re not aware of. Be careful not to let your obsession with just a few possibilities blind you to all the others.

Clarify your intentions, set your goals, and go for them. But never let that stop you from being open to everything else that is possible.

— Ralph Marston
